CPK Is Encouraging Return Visits With A "Mystery Envelope" Promotion

CpkCalifornia Pizza Kitchen (CPK) has just started a new marketing promotion designed to encourage repeat visitors.

They're handing out almost 2 million thank you cards to customers dining at their full service restaurants across the nation. Each party will receive an envelope with their check which contains a guaranteed prize, ranging from 10% off a meal to $25,000.

The repeat visit angle: The mystery promotion requires you to come back to the restaurant at a later date, and ask a CPK manager to personally open the envelope to reveal the prize. The company says that every company-owned CPK full-service restaurant expects to have hundreds of winners.
